Change History Log Examples
Example 1:
Parameter 4 (ready delay) was changed.
Example 2:
If the LED on the gun key is on, then this display would
indicate that the global-by-component method was used to change the
temperature of the guns.
Unused log entries in the change history log are
indicated by “P-_” in the right display.
To view how many heater hours have elapsed
since a specific change (displayed) was made,
simultaneously press both of the right-display
scroll keys.
